
WARSAW — The Greater Warsaw Ministerial Association has designated this Sunday, Sept. 24, as Hunger Awareness Sunday. Churches, individuals and organizations are encouraged to take a moment to pray for those in need around the world who face hunger issues and the recent areas affected by Hurricanes and to support with financial gifts.
The 33rd Annual Kosciusko Crop Hunger Walk will be held at The Salvation Army, 501 E. Arthur St., Warsaw, with registration beginning at 1 and the walk at 1:30 p.m. Donations from the walk will support Church World Service and The Salvation Army.
